Indonesian steel plant Jatim Taman to increase its capacity

Japan's Mitsubishi Steel Corporation announced that it will increase the capital of Indonesian subsidiary Jatim Taman.

Indonesian steel plant Jatim Taman to increase its capacity

Mitsubishi Steel aims to strengthen its cooperation with Jatim through investment and also assist its major customers in the automotive and machinery manufacturing industries, by increasing demand from Indonesia and other countries in Southeast Asia.

Mitsubishi Steel started providing technical support to Jatim in 2010. Now Japan's Mitsubishi Steel Corporation will increase 500 billion rupiah (about US$32.4 million) of capital to its Indonesian subsidiary Jatim Taman before the end of this month for capacity expansion and shareholding to meet the rapidly growing demand in the ASEAN market. Thus, the capacity ratio will increase from 66.54% to 74.98%. The steel plant is currently operating at full capacity.
